Win win with SA businesses conserving waterIn October, as part of National Water Week, South Australian Minister for Water Resources, Mark Brindal, launched a video highlighting five demonstration sites where businesses are conserving water. An initiative of Marion and Mitcham Councils in Adelaide, and funded through the National Heritage Trust Agreement, the aim is to encourage businesses and industry to reduce their use of mains water, through various conservation measures. Research has shown that cost effective industrial water conservation measures can save between 25-40 percent of original water use, and can go as high as 90 percent. Launched at Marion Council, the 85 people who attended gave very favourable feedback on the video. The demonstration sites show how a rethink of procedures can result in substantial environmental and cost savings for businesses. Actions put in place include recycling water many times over and using roof water runoff instead of mains water. For their efforts, the five businesses were presented with a framed certificate by the Minister. Collectively, the five sites are saving in excess of 300,000 litres of mains water per annum. A catchment tour following the launch of the video provided an opportunity for the public to view the demonstration sites. Information about the activities undertaken by the participating businesses to reduce their water use is also available on the both Councils' web sites. The video explains how a reduction in consumption means less water has to be pumped from the Murray River to supplement Adelaide's reservoirs. This leaves extra water for vital environmental flows needed to keep the Murray healthy. The alternative is increased salinity levels that will ultimately lead to increased costs for industry through corrosion of pipes, machinery and hot water systems.
